The first royal governor who took office in 1710. It was all it was also the home of our first state governors. Patrick henry and Thomas Jefferson. And have a very orderly design. It was the thirdlargest building in town. It consisted not only of the building we are standing in, but there was a can now, a scullery, a laundry, kitchen. We know that one governor actually had 5000 models in his cellar. The house today is a reconstructed building on an architectural site. It was open to the public in 1934. Since then it has undergone refurbishing and interpretations. One governor arrived in 1774. At the end of that year, lady dunmore gave birth to a daughter. Unfortunately, things went sour between the relationship of the governor and the virginians, and in 1775, the governor and his family fled in darkness, never to return again. American history tv from colonial Williams Burg. Heres a tour of the governors palace. Im one of the curators of textiles and historic here at colonial Williams Burg foundation. Right now, were at the governors palace. It would have been a symbol of power and authority and represented power to the columnists of virginia. The building was on the home of seven royal governors, including alexander, the first royal governor who took office in 1710. The house was an important part of the design of the town of Williams Burg. It consisted not only of the building that were standing in, but also to the advance buildings and even a sell lar. We know that one governor had over 5,000, almost 6,000 bottles of wine stored in his sell lar. The house today is a reconstructed building on the original archaeological site.
